SADM05 Underwater Automatic Dredging Equipment is an automated device for underwater dredging on the seabed, designed to address situations where divers are not suitable for long-term underwater operations, where the amount of mud is large, and where space is limited. It achieves the automated operation of the underwater dredging equipment through remote control from a surface vessel. 

1. Equipment Composition 

The SADM05 underwater automatic dredging equipment mainly consists of four modules: the underwater operation system, the water surface control system, the pipeline retraction and deployment device, and the navigation system. 

2 Product Features 

2.1 The underwater operation system adopts a multi-degree-of-freedom robotic arm, a tracked self-propelled chassis, a hydraulic power drive unit, a jet pump and its power drive unit, a umbilical cable terminal, and a variety of underwater-specific sensors for a highly integrated design. This simplifies the connection between the underwater operation system and the surface control system, allowing the operator to complete various heavy underwater operations remotely through an electric control handle on the surface. 

2.2 The jet pump adopts the introduction method of circular jet power fluid, which significantly improves the passability of sediment particles. There are no eroded or moving parts on the flow channel, greatly extending the service life of the jet pump. 

2.3 The large-diameter jet pump, combined with a high-power jet power station and dredging cutter, features a large amount of sludge discharge and high sludge discharge efficiency. 

2.4 The underwater hydraulic system is equipped with a pressure compensation device, which enhances the waterproof sealing performance of the equipment. 

2.5 The underwater automatic dredging equipment is equipped with various underwater-specific sensors such as position and orientation sensors, depth sensors, height sensors, cameras, sonars, and fault alarms, providing visual monitoring and navigation functions for the water-based operations. 

3 Technical Specifications 

3.1 Working water depth: 40 meters; 

3.2 Sand hardness: 20 KPa; 

3.3 Mud-sand shear strength: 35 - 40 KPa; 

3.4 Dredging capacity: 48 cubic meters per hour; 

3.5 Maximum power: 130kw; 

3.6 Power Supply: 380VAC @ 50HZ;
